About Francesco Costa

Francesco Costa is a scholar working on Nuclear and High Energy Physics, Astronomy and Astrophysics and Oceanography, having authored 16 papers that have together received 303 indexed citations. Recurring topics across this work include Cosmology and Gravitation Theories (14 papers), Dark Matter and Cosmic Phenomena (7 papers) and Galaxies: Formation, Evolution, Phenomena (6 papers). The work is most often cited by research in Nuclear and High Energy Physics (244 citations), Astronomy and Astrophysics (284 citations) and Statistical and Nonlinear Physics (33 citations). Francesco Costa has collaborated with scholars based in Brazil, Germany and Finland. Frequent co-authors include J. S. Alcaniz, J. A. S. Lima, Spyros Basilakos, Jinsu Kim, Oleg Lebedev, Jackson Max Furtunato Maia, Edésio M. Barboza, Leila L. Graef, Andreas Goudelis and Giorgio Arcadi. Their work appears in journals such as Physics Letters B, Journal of High Energy Physics and Physical review. D.
